Pecco Bagnaia

Pecco Bagnaia is happy with his Saturday at Sepang at the end of which he noted great progress on his GP23. The rain has certainly delayed his work plan with a new motorcycle on which he is focusing exclusively. But it also completely reassured him about his ability to ride in these conditions, a confidence that the previous version had never given him. He also talks about aerodynamics which imposes new physical constraints on pilots. An element that will have to be remembered in a season with 21 meetings and 42 races…

Unlike his teammate Enea Bastianini, who, it is true, has not experienced the GP22, riding with a GP21 last year with Gresini, the World Champion Pecco Bagnaia drives exclusively with the Ducati 2023. ' It has a lot of potential, and compared to Friday, we took a huge step forward » rejoices number 1. “ We were close to the 2022 spec. On Sunday we will work in the same direction. With the engine we are already at the same level as the old one, which is very important ».

And it’s not just that: “ I tested a new fork slightly longer. I also see a lot of potential here, but more development is needed. But I was only able to take it out twice, because then it started to rain ". But even when the drops fall, satisfaction remains: “ in the rain, we took a big step forward compared to last year, which I am very happy with. Last year I always tripped in the wet, I have a very good feeling with this bike – as in 2021 » assures the Italian who has not really commented his incident on the track with Pol Espargaró .

In short, his opponents have something to worry about... Sunday, bagnaia must complete a race simulation with the new engine, and a new swingarm will also be used. There remains the aerodynamic question, a central subject in today's MotoGP. Pecco Bagnaia does not deny it and especially since he recognizes that it really impacts the physical condition of the rider... For now, the eleven-time winner in MotoGP has opted for an aero package without "ground effect", it 'that is to say a fairing without steps which provides additional contact pressure in the inclined position… " For now, I prefer the other fairing, but I will try the new one again during the Portimao tests “, revealed Pecco.

Then he adds: “ I think I'll ride with whatever makes me go faster., and if I get more tired, so be it. We are physically prepared to face many races, many laps ". He still reassures: “ you don't get to a point where you have trouble riding. For me, if something makes me go faster I use it! ».

On the subject, he specifies: “ aerodynamics ultimately affects everything. Except on the straight, where you don't feel anything different between first and sixth gear. But it affects wheelies, braking, rapid turns and changes of direction. It's something that does a lot. The biggest improvement between the 2021 and 2022 bikes is the fairing, which was smaller before ". Tomorrow Sunday, Pecco Bagnaia would like to do a race simulation… Sprint.
